Автомобильные мультимедийные системы на базе Android со временем могут сталкиваться с критическими сбоями: зависанием интерфейса, потерей сигнала GPS или невозможностью запуска приложений. В таких ситуациях единственным выходом становится вход в специальный режим восстановления, известный как Recovery Mode. Этот скрытый раздел операционной системы позволяет выполнить сброс настроек, обновить прошивку или удалить кэш, что часто возвращает устройство к жизни без необходимости обращения в сервисный центр.

Особенность многих китайских магнитол заключается в отсутствии физических кнопок на корпусе, необходимых для вызова этого режима. Производители часто экономят на механике, полагаясь на программное управление. Однако для энтузиастов и ремонтников существует надежный способ обойти это ограничение — использование внешней клавиатуры. Подключение стандартного USB-устройства ввода открывает доступ к скрытому меню, где можно выполнить практически любые манипуляции с системным разделом.

Подготовка оборудования и выбор периферии

Прежде чем пытаться выполнить какие-либо действия, необходимо убедиться в совместимости вашего оборудования. Не всякая клавиатура подойдет для входа в Recovery, так как система должна распознать устройство ввода еще до загрузки основной операционной системы. Вам понадобится проводная USB-клавиатура или беспроводная модель с надежным приемником, работающая в режиме эмуляции HID-устройства.

Важно проверить физическое состояние портов на магнитоле. Часто в автомобилях используются удлинители или переходники, которые могут создавать помехи при передаче сигналов. Идеальный вариант — прямое подключение в USB 2.0 порт, расположенный непосредственно на плате магнитолы. Если у вас модель с двумя портами, попробуйте оба, так как один из них может быть настроен только на вывод данных, а не на ввод команд.

  • ✅ Используйте клавиатуры с минимальным набором функций (без подсветки и лишних макросов)
  • ✅ Проверьте работоспособность клавиатуры на другом устройстве перед подключением
  • ✅ Имейте под рукой USB-хаб, если портов на магнитоле недостаточно

Некоторые пользователи сталкиваются с тем, что клавиатура не определяется в режиме восстановления. Это происходит из-за отсутствия драйверов в загрузочном образе U-Boot. В таких случаях рекомендуется использовать самые простые модели клавиатур, которые не требуют дополнительной инициализации. Сложные игровые панели или мультимедийные клавиатуры часто не работают на низком уровне системы.

⚠️ Внимание: Убедитесь, что аккумулятор вашего автомобиля заряжен не менее чем на 50%. Процесс входа в режим восстановления и последующие манипуляции могут потребовать значительного энергопотребления, а внезапное отключение питания во время работы с системным разделом может привести к необратимой порче прошивки.

Алгоритм входа через комбинацию клавиш

Самый распространенный метод входа в Recovery Mode с клавиатуры требует точной синхронизации действий. Вам необходимо удерживать специальную комбинацию клавиш в момент подачи питания на устройство. Обычно это сочетание клавиш Esc, Home или Menu, но конкретная комбинация зависит от модели чипсета и версии прошивки.

Для начала отключите магнитолу от питания полностью. Выньте предохранитель или отсоедините провод массы от аккумулятора на 30 секунд, чтобы гарантировать полный сброс энергии в конденсаторах. После этого подключите клавиатуру и нажмите и удерживайте ключевую комбинацию. Только после этого подайте питание на устройство, не отпуская зажатые кнопки.

Если вы все сделали верно, на экране появится логотип производителя или заставка Android, а затем меню с синим или черным фоном. В этом меню навигация осуществляется стрелками клавиатуры, а выбор подтверждается клавишей Enter. Если вы упустили момент включения, повторите процедуру, увеличив время удержания клавиш перед подачей питания.

📊 Какая у вас модель магнитолы?
  • Teyes
  • Pioneer
  • Xtrons
  • Generic (Китайская)

Навигация и основные команды в меню

Попав в меню восстановления, вы увидите список опций, которые могут отличаться в зависимости от версии Android и кастомизации производителя. Стандартный интерфейс Recovery предлагает выбор пунктов с помощью стрелок вверх и вниз. Ключевые команды обычно включают Wipe data/factory reset для полного сброса или Wipe cache partition для очистки временных файлов.

Особое внимание уделите пункту Apply update from ADB. Он позволяет обновить систему через компьютер, если стандартный способ через USB-флешку не работает. Для этого потребуется установить драйверы ADB и Fastboot на ПК и подключить магнитолу кабелем. Это продвинутый метод, требующий знаний командной строки.

  • 🔹 Reboot system now — перезагрузка устройства в нормальный режим
  • 🔹 Wipe data/factory reset — полное удаление всех данных пользователя
  • 🔹 Power off — выключение устройства без перезагрузки

В некоторых версиях меню можно использовать клавишу Space для подтверждения выбора, если Enter не реагирует. Это частая проблема на старых прошивках, где код ввода настроен специфически. Если меню не реагирует на нажатия, попробуйте отсоединить и снова подключить клавиатуру, не перезагружая устройство.

⚠️ Внимание: Пункт Wipe data/factory reset удаляет все установленные приложения, настройки навигации и сохраненные данные. Перед выполнением этой операции убедитесь, что у вас есть резервная копия важных файлов, если система позволяет их скопировать перед сбросом.

Таблица популярных комбинаций клавиш

Поскольку производители не всегда документируют способы входа в Recovery, мы собрали наиболее часто встречающиеся комбинации для различных чипсетов и платформ. Используйте эту таблицу как справочный материал, если стандартные методы не срабатывают.

Платформа / Чипсет Комбинация клавиш Особенности
Rockchip (RK3229, RK3328) Esc + Enter Удерживать при включении питания
Allwinner (A31, A33) F2 или Del Нажимать сразу после подачи тока
MediaTek (MT8227) Home + Menu Часто требует двойного нажатия
Unisoc (SC9863A) Esc + F1 Меню может появиться через 5-10 секунд

Если ни одна из комбинаций не работает, возможно, производитель заблокировал доступ к Recovery или изменил стандартный протокол. В таких случаях иногда помогает удержание клавиши Volume Up (если магнитола имеет физический регулятор громкости) вместе с клавиатурой. Также стоит попробовать клавишу F12, которая в некоторых BIOS-подобных загрузчиках вызывает меню выбора устройства.

☑️ Проверка перед сбросом

Выполнено: 0 / 4

Решение проблем с отсутствием реакции

Иногда клавиатура физически определяется системой (светятся индикаторы), но не реагирует на нажатия в меню Recovery. Это может быть связано с конфликтом протоколов USB или неправильной инициализацией драйверов клавиатуры на уровне ядра. Попробуйте изменить порт подключения или использовать другой тип кабеля, если это беспроводная модель.

Другая распространенная проблема — экран остается черным, но звук работы системы присутствует. В этом случае попробуйте нажать клавишу Brightness Up или комбинацию управления подсветкой. Иногда в режиме Recovery яркость экрана сбрасывается на минимум, и пользователь думает, что устройство зависло.

Что делать, если клавиатура не работает?

Если клавиатура не реагирует, попробуйте подключить её к другому USB-порту. Попробуйте использовать клавиатуру от другого производителя. В некоторых случаях помогает предварительная загрузка в Android, подключение клавиатуры там и использование специальных приложений для вызова Recovery.

Если магнитола зависла на логотипе и не реагирует на клавиатуру, возможно, сбой произошел на уровне загрузчика. В таком случае может потребоваться прошивка через SP Flash Tool или аналогичный софт для вашего чипсета. Это более сложный процесс, требующий наличия файлов прошивки именно для вашей модели.

💡

Перед началом любых манипуляций запишите модель процессора и версию текущей прошивки в настройках Android, если есть возможность. Это критически важно для поиска совместимых драйверов и утилит прошивки.

Выход из режима и перезагрузка

После выполнения необходимых действий в меню Recovery, например, сброса настроек или обновления прошивки, необходимо корректно выйти из режима. Для этого выберите пункт Reboot system now и нажмите Enter. Не выключайте устройство принудительно через отключение питания, так как это может привести к повреждению файловой системы.

Первая загрузка после сброса может занять от 5 до 15 минут. Это нормальное явление, так как система перестраивает файлы и кэш. Не паникуйте, если экран остается черным или показывает анимацию долго. Если через 20 минут устройство не загрузилось, попробуйте повторить процедуру входа в Recovery и выполнить сброс еще раз.

После успешной загрузки проверьте работу всех функций магнитолы: Bluetooth, Wi-Fi, навигацию и выход в интернет. Если какие-то модули не работают, возможно, потребуется установка дополнительных драйверов или обновление прошивки до более стабильной версии.

💡

Корректный выход из режима Recovery через пункт Reboot system now гарантирует целостность файловой системы и предотвращает возникновение ошибок загрузки при первом старте.

⚠️ Внимание: Если после сброса настроек магнитола не видит карту памяти или USB-флешки, проверьте форматирование накопителей. В режиме Recovery может измениться система файловой таблицы, и устройства могут потребовать форматирования в FAT32 для корректной работы.

Дополнительные методы доступа

Если использование клавиатуры не дает результата, можно попробовать войти в Recovery через ADB-команды, если система Android еще загружается. Для этого включите режим отладки по USB в настройках разработчика и подключите магнитолу к компьютеру. Через терминал можно отправить команду на принудительный перезапуск в режим восстановления.

Команда для ввода выглядит следующим образом:

adb reboot recovery
Эта команда работает только при работающей ОС и установленных драйверах ADB. Это самый надежный программный способ, если аппаратные методы недоступны. Однако, если система не загружается, этот метод не сработает.

Некоторые пользователи используют специальные приложения из Google Play Store, которые могут вызвать меню Recovery через интерфейс. Это удобно, но не всегда доступно, если система уже нестабильна. Используйте этот метод только как вспомогательный, когда есть доступ к рабочему интерфейсу.

Как проверить версию ядра?

Для получения информации о версии ядра используйте команду в терминале: uname -r. Это поможет найти точную прошивку для вашего устройства.

Часто задаваемые вопросы

Можно ли войти в Recovery без клавиатуры?

Да, на некоторых моделях это возможно через комбинацию физических кнопок на корпусе (громкость + питание) или через специальные приложения, если система загружается.

Что делать, если клавиатура работает, но не видит меню?

Попробуйте сменить порт USB, использовать другую клавиатуру или проверить, не заблокирован ли ввод на уровне загрузчика. Иногда помогает перезагрузка устройства с уже подключенной клавиатурой.

Безопасно ли делать сброс настроек через Recovery?

Да, это стандартная процедура, но она удаляет все пользовательские данные. Обязательно сделайте резервную копию важных файлов перед выполнением сброса.

Можно ли обновить прошивку через Recovery с клавиатуры?

Да, если вы выбрали пункт Apply update from SD card или Apply update from ADB, навигация по меню осуществляется именно с помощью клавиатуры.

Что делать, если после сброса магнитола не включается?

В этом случае требуется перепрошивка через специализированный софт (SP Flash Tool, Rockchip Batch Tool) и наличие файла прошивки для вашей модели. Обратитесь к документации производителя.